Company Filing History:
Years Active: 2005-2014
Title: Innovations of Kenneth L McMillan
Introduction
Kenneth L McMillan is a prominent inventor based in Berkeley, CA, known for his significant contributions to the field of design verification. With a total of nine patents to his name, McMillan has made substantial advancements in algorithms that enhance the functionality of circuits and software.
Latest Patents
One of McMillan's latest patents is a general numeric backtracking algorithm for solving satisfiability problems. This invention focuses on verifying the functionality of circuits and software. In one embodiment, the design verifier includes a model extractor and a bounded model checker equipped with an arithmetic satisfiability solver. The solver searches for a solution by assigning numeric values to variables that satisfy multiple numeric formulas. When conflicts arise during the search, new numeric formulas are deduced to guide the search toward a solution. If a numeric assignment is found that satisfies all formulas, it indicates a violation of a functional property within the system. Another patent with a similar focus is an apparatus that employs the same general numeric backtracking algorithm to verify the functionality of circuits and software.
Career Highlights
Kenneth L McMillan is currently associated with Cadence Design Systems, Inc., where he continues to innovate in the realm of design verification. His work has been instrumental in developing tools that enhance the reliability and efficiency of electronic designs.
Collaborations
Throughout his career, McMillan has collaborated with notable colleagues, including Robert Paul Kurshan and Nina Amla, contributing to various advancements in the field.
Conclusion
Kenneth L McMillan's contributions to the field of design verification through his innovative patents and collaborations have significantly impacted the industry. His work continues to pave the way for advancements in circuit and software functionality verification.